Output 13c03b4153800d90ce0a2b81ad4e4f1d8f41c54da71a634173e12d74b7a40131:5

value
120834000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f391900f607df9a89db967c551f13efccc4fcb19 OP_EQUAL
address
3PttW2xqWU3BUeRkeUpK1snvpuyb8mKkP9
transaction
13c03b4153800d90ce0a2b81ad4e4f1d8f41c54da71a634173e12d74b7a40131
confirmations
315622
spent
true